What is the Normal Hemoglobin Level?
A normal hemoglobin level for an adult is between 12 to 18 grams per 100 milliliters of blood. Dehydration and lung disease causes above normal levels. Anemia, kidney and liver disease can cause an abnormal low level. Read More »

What are Normal Hemoglobin Levels?
Hemoglobin levels are based on gender and age. They are measured in grams per deciliter (dl) of whole blood. Normal hemoglobin levels for adult males is 14-18 gm/dl. Normal for an adult female is 12-16 gm/dl. Read More »

How to Increase Hemoglobin Level?
To increase your hemoglobin level, each plenty of foods that are rich in iron. Red meats, liver and iron rich cereals are good choices. You can also increase your vitamin C intake as vitamin C enhances the absorption of iron in the body. Read More »
